The quickest and simplest would be to get the mini-dv tapes.
However, there is an excellent free application, which would solve a
lot of the recent conversion problems people have been having, called
Mpeg-streamclip. You can get it here
<http://www.alfanet.it/squared5/mpegstreamclip.html>.
I was just reading the help file on it to see if it could pull just
the aiff out of the dvd when I also noticed that it specifically
mentions dealing with EyeTV streams. It also does a great job of
converting MPEGs to quicktimes. You will need to get Apple's Mpeg 2
component for some operations.
I'm not familiar with iMovie at all, but another method that might
work is to attach your dvd player to your camera, and your camera to
your mac, and play the dvd in via E to E mode - capturing it with
iMovie.
I do this with FCP all the time, and it is the quickest and simplest
solution, being realtime.
